Recap: Stamford Bulldogs vs. Paducah Dragons
The Stamford Bulldogs's three-game losing streak came to an end on Thursday. They took down Paducah 57-43. The win was just what Stamford needed coming off of a 81-29 loss in their prior match.
Paducah's defeat came despite a true team effort from the offense, with many players turning in solid performances. Perhaps the best among them was Jakyen Wright, who scored 19 points. The game was Wright's ninth in a row with at least ten points. Darren Mackey was another key contributor, scoring 11 points.
Stamford's victory bumped their record up to 2-4. As for Paducah, this is the second loss in a row for them and nudges their season record down to 6-4.
Stamford will be playing at home against Olney at 6:30 p.m. on Tuesday. As for Paducah, they will head out on the road to face off against Aspermont at 8:00 p.m. on Friday.
